Marcelinho Huertas is a Brazilian-Italian professional basketball player renowned for his skills as a point guard.

Player Archetype / Play Style

Marcelinho Huertas’s player archetype is that of a classic pass-first floor general, a veteran point guard whose game has long revolved around tempo control, live-dribble playmaking and the kind of composure that lets an offense breathe. Defensively, he fits more as a cerebral team defender than a pressure-based stopper, using positioning, anticipation and experience to survive despite not being an overpowering athlete at this stage of his career. Offensively, his role is to run the show, manipulate pick-and-roll coverages, create easy looks for teammates and chip in with timely scoring when defenses sag or overplay the pass. Physically, Huertas has a solid 6-foot-3 guard frame with excellent balance and craft more than burst, and his overall style is built on patience, vision and surgical decision-making, making him the type of lead guard who controls games with brains, rhythm and precision rather than force.
